.workflow-html-circle{pointer-events:none;font-family:CA Sans-Regular,Verdana,Calibri;-webkit-user-select:none;border-radius:30px;border:1px solid #258622;z-index:2;font-size:12px;color:#262829;text-align:center;line-height:34px;position:absolute}.workflow-html-circle label{max-width:100%;overflow:hidden;white-space:nowrap;text-overflow:ellipsis}#paper-html-elements{position:relative;border:1px solid gray;display:inline-block;background:0 0;overflow:hidden}#paper-html-elements svg{background:0 0}#paper-html-elements svg .link{z-index:2}.workflow-html-element{font-size:12px;color:#262829;text-align:center;position:absolute;background:#fff;pointer-events:none;-webkit-user-select:none;border-radius:4px;font-family:CA Sans-Regular,Verdana,Calibri;border:1px solid #b0b0b0;border-left-width:3px;box-shadow:none;padding:5px;box-sizing:border-box;z-index:2;display:flex;align-items:center;justify-content:center}.workflow-html-element button,.workflow-html-element input,.workflow-html-element select{pointer-events:auto}.workflow-html-element label{margin-bottom:0;max-width:100%;overflow:hidden;white-space:nowrap;text-overflow:ellipsis}.workflow-html-element button.workflow-delete-button{display:none;border:none;background-color:transparent;width:14px;height:14px;position:absolute;top:-11px;left:-11px;padding:0;margin:0;cursor:pointer}.workflow-html-element select{position:absolute;right:2px;bottom:28px}.workflow-html-element input{position:absolute;bottom:0;left:0;right:0;border:none;color:#333;padding:5px;height:16px}.workflow-html-element span{position:absolute;top:2px;right:9px;color:#fff;font-size:10px}.workflow-taskEditImageHolder{background-color:transparent;position:absolute;cursor:pointer;display:none;float:right;width:16px;height:16px;border:1px solid #b0b0b0;border-radius:2px;right:0;bottom:0;padding:0}.workflow-html-element.border:before{border:1px dashed #236cff;content:"";position:absolute;top:-5px;bottom:-5px;left:-7px;right:-5px}.workflow-taskEditImage{margin-left:auto;margin-top:auto;display:block}.workflow-deleteTaskImage{width:14px;height:14px}.Body{margin:0}.workflowDesignerContainer{padding-top:30px}.closeButtonContainer{margin-top:-5px;float:right}.closeButtonImage{padding-right:40px;float:right;transform:scale(.7)}.workflowDesignerHeaderContainer{font-size:14px;font-weight:700;padding-left:24px;padding-bottom:33px}.workflowDesignerHorizontalDivider{margin:0}.workflowToolbarContainer{height:37px}.workflowToolbarHeader{font-size:14px;font-weight:700;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;width:120px;margin-left:24px;float:left;margin-top:10px}.workflowToolbarDivider{width:1px;margin-left:12px;background-color:#aaa;height:100%;float:left}.workflowToolbarIconContainerTask{margin-top:6px;margin-left:26px;float:left}.workflowToolbarIconContainerZoom{margin-top:10px;margin-left:26px;float:left}.workflowToolbarIconContainerUndoRedo{margin-top:6px;margin-left:26px;float:left}.taskicon{float:left;border:1px solid #aaa;border-radius:5px;height:24px;width:32px;font-size:12px;color:#aaa;font-weight:700;margin-left:12px;cursor:all-scroll;line-height:22px;text-align:center}.grouptaskicon{float:left;border:1px solid #aaa;border-radius:5px;height:24px;width:32px;font-size:12px;color:#aaa;font-weight:700;cursor:all-scroll;line-height:22px;text-align:center}.secondIcon{margin-left:6px}.workflowToolbarSave{margin-top:6px;width:75px;height:25px;float:right;margin-right:60px;font-weight:700;color:#000;background-color:#53bbd4;border:none;font-family:CA Sans-Bold,Verdana,Calibri;border-radius:0}.workflowDesignerPaperContainer{width:100%;overflow:auto}.wfGraphicalViewContainer{margin:0 auto}button.diagPanel{background-color:#424568;border-radius:0 0;color:#444;cursor:pointer;padding:18px;width:100%;text-align:left;border-bottom:0 solid gray;outline:0;max-height:.2s ease-out}#controlPanelTopStripe{background-color:#424568;width:244px;height:30px;cursor:pointer}button.diagPanel.active,button.diagPanel:hover{background-color:#ddd}#controlPanel{border:0 solid gray;border-radius:0 0;background:#383b61;padding:22px}#drawingArea{border:2px solid gray;border-radius:15px 15px;background:#f6f6f6}#backgroundForDrawing{padding:20px}#presentationPanel{border:0 solid gray;border-radius:0 0;background:#383b61;padding:20px;width:204px;height:70px}#presentationPanelContent{border:0 solid gray;border-radius:0 0;background:#383b61;width:204px;height:70px;display:none;padding:1px}#textPanel{border:0 solid gray;border-radius:0 0;background:#383b61;padding:20px;width:204px;height:90px}#textPanelContent{border:0 solid gray;border-radius:0 0;background:#383b61;width:204px;height:70px;display:none;padding:1px}#propertiesPanel{border:0 solid gray;border-radius:0 0;background:#383b61;padding:20px;width:204px;height:250px}#propertiesPanelContent{border-radius:0 0;background:#383b61;padding:1px;width:204px;height:300px;display:none}#behaviorPanel{border-radius:0 0;background:#383b61;padding:0;width:244px;height:250px}#behaviorPanelContent{border-radius:0 0;background:#383b61;padding:0;width:244px;height:300px;display:none}#paper-html-elements{position:relative;border:1px solid gray;display:inline-block;background:0 0;overflow:hidden}#paper-html-elements svg{background:0 0}#paper-html-elements svg .link{z-index:2}.html-element{position:absolute;background:#383b61;pointer-events:none;-webkit-user-select:none;border-radius:20px;border:1px solid #31d0c6;box-shadow:inset 0 0 5px #000,2px 2px 1px gray;padding:5px;box-sizing:border-box;z-index:2;width:80px;height:80px}.html-element button,.html-element input,.html-element select{pointer-events:auto}.html-element div.sdm-task{color:#fff;border:none;background-color:#383b61;border-radius:10px;width:80px;height:80px;line-height:15px;text-align:middle;position:absolute;top:-15px;left:-15px;padding:0;margin:0;font-weight:700;cursor:pointer}.html-element button.delete{color:#fff;border:none;background-color:#c0392b;border-radius:20px;width:15px;height:15px;line-height:15px;text-align:middle;position:absolute;top:-15px;left:-15px;padding:0;margin:0;font-weight:700;cursor:pointer}.html-element button.delete:hover{width:20px;height:20px;line-height:20px}.html-element select{position:absolute;right:2px;bottom:28px}.html-element input{position:absolute;bottom:0;left:10;right:0;border:5px;color:#333;padding:5px;height:16px}.html-element label.desc{color:#333;text-shadow:1px 0 0 #d3d3d3;font-weight:700;position:absolute;bottom:50;left:60px;right:0;border:5px;padding:5px;height:16px}.html-element span{position:absolute;top:2px;right:9px;color:#fff;font-size:10px}.form-style-2{max-width:500px;padding:20px 12px 10px 20px;font:13px Arial,Helvetica,sans-serif}.form-style-2-heading{color:#fff;border-bottom:1px solid #ddd;margin-bottom:20px;font-size:10px;padding-bottom:0}.form-style-2 label{display:block;margin:0 0 15px 0}.form-style-2 label>span{width:100px;float:left;padding-top:1px;padding-right:5px;color:#fff}.form-style-2 span.required{color:red}.form-style-2 .tel-number-field{width:40px;text-align:center}.form-style-2 input.input-field{width:100%}.form-style-2 .select-field,.form-style-2 .tel-number-field,.form-style-2 .textarea-field,.form-style-2 input.input-field{box-sizing:border-box;-webkit-box-sizing:border-box;-moz-box-sizing:border-box;border:1px solid #c2c2c2;box-shadow:1px 1px 4px #ebebeb;-moz-box-shadow:1px 1px 4px #ebebeb;-webkit-box-shadow:1px 1px 4px #ebebeb;border-radius:3px;-webkit-border-radius:3px;-moz-border-radius:3px;padding:7px;outline:0}.form-style-2 .input-field:focus,.form-style-2 .select-field:focus,.form-style-2 .tel-number-field:focus,.form-style-2 .textarea-field:focus{border:1px solid #0c0}.form-style-2 .textarea-field{height:100px;width:55%}.form-style-2 input[type=button],.form-style-2 input[type=submit]{border:none;padding:8px 15px 8px 15px;background:#ff8500;color:#fff;box-shadow:1px 1px 4px #dadada;-moz-box-shadow:1px 1px 4px #dadada;-webkit-box-shadow:1px 1px 4px #dadada;border-radius:3px;-webkit-border-radius:3px;-moz-border-radius:3px}.form-style-2 input[type=button]:hover,.form-style-2 input[type=submit]:hover{background:#ea7b00;color:#fff}.cssCircle{-webkit-border-radius:999px;-moz-border-radius:999px;border-radius:999px;behavior:url(PIE.htc);width:14px;height:14px;padding:0;background:#779bca;border:1px solid #003580;color:#003580;text-align:center;-webkit-transition:background .2s linear;-moz-transition:background .2s linear;-ms-transition:background .2s linear;-o-transition:background .2s linear;transition:background .2s linear;transition:color .2s linear;font:13px Arial,sans-serif}.cssCircle:hover{background:#3f69a0;cursor:pointer}.minusSign{line-height:.9em;margin-bottom:1px}.plusSign{line-height:1.1em}.minusSign:hover,.plusSign:hover{color:#fff}#outline{width:30px;height:30px;border-radius:5px;background:383b61;border:1px solid #31d0c6;cursor:pointer}#fill{width:31px;height:31px;border-radius:5px;background:red;cursor:pointer}.round-button{width:50%}.round-button-circle{width:100%;height:0;padding-bottom:100%;border-radius:70%;border:10px solid #cfdcec;overflow:hidden;background:#4679bd;box-shadow:0 0 3px gray}.round-button-circle:hover{background:#30588e}.round-button a{display:block;float:left;width:100%;padding-top:30%;padding-bottom:50%;line-height:1em;margin-top:-.5em;text-align:center;color:#e2eaf3;font-family:Verdana;font-size:1.2em;font-weight:700;text-decoration:none}